Ticket #DRV-state: Locked vault blocking nightly search reindex. The Quillmere reindex job on cluster fenwick-7 failed at 02:14 because the credentials vault sealed itself after a node restart. Security reviewer: no evidence of tampering; seal was triggered by the standard integrity check. Reindex will resume once the vault is unsealed manually. Per procedure, unsealing requires the recovery passphrase recorded immediately below.

vault phrase of fahog-yajog = frawyn-jordor-casael-gormir-olieth-julmir

Matchwell's pairing service showed 2–4s GC pauses during Tuesday's load test, traced to oversized candidate buffers. Mitigation: cap buffer size at 10k entries and enable incremental collection in the service flags. Pause times now stay under 200ms. To pull GC telemetry from the internal Gaugeport dashboard during verification, authenticate with the following key.

API key for yahig-tadup: kto7_ubizbYm

- [ ] **Step 7: Breaker override escrow.** After sealing the signing keys for the Tallgrove upstream API circuit breaker, confirm the support team can force the breaker open during a full outage. The override bundle lives in the sealed escrow drawer and is useless without its unlock phrase. Two ceremony witnesses must initial this step before proceeding. The escrow bundle is decrypted with the recovery passphrase that follows.

vault phrase of kahip-kahop = holath-quenmir

**Postmortem timeline — Driftpage incremental rebuild stampede**

14:02 — A malformed frontmatter change in the Saltgrove docs repo invalidated the dependency graph, so the "incremental" rebuild decided literally every page was dirty. 14:09 — Build queue on the Driftpage cluster hit 40k jobs and workers started OOMing. Lesson for future maintainers: the graph invalidator treats parse errors as "rebuild everything," which is... a choice. We've since capped fan-out at 2k pages. The triggering build's token is noted below.

session token of tajef-bageg = htk21_5d90d574934f3ccae6437